Montage Partners acquires National Home Warranty, Inc., a provider of home warranty services.
Transaction overview
Montage Partners, a people-first private equity firm based in Scottsdale, Arizona, has acquired National Home Warranty, Inc., a leading provider of home warranty services in the United States. While details such as the deal value and the exact close date have not been disclosed, the acquisition aims to expand Montage Partners' portfolio within the consumer sector. National Home Warranty offers comprehensive repair and replacement coverage for homeowners across various states.
